For this fall, I’m really feeling the jewel tones (for those of you who know me well, this should not be a surprise). Whether a juicy shade of winey plum or a navy so dark it’s almost black, I love the impact a darker nail can have. Polish with an edge (pun intended). This time of year is also when I go for the metallics; not the bright sparkly golds or silvers you might see around the holidays, but the ‘dirty’, antique gold shades, ones with a hint of green in them. If you’re a bit more color averse than I am, nudes are still a great option for Fall, but go for something warmer, less pink more sandy brown. And if you’re looking to buck the trend while sticking with the season, try a bright orangey-red; it’s unexpected but still pairs well with flannels and over the knee boots.
Whether you’re willing to throw down some cash for your fingers and toes, or if you want a pop of color without the price tag, here are my favorite colors for Fall and my recommendations at every price point.
If you’re feelin’ fancy…

1. Guerlain Color Lacquer in L’Heure Bleue, $25. 2. Butter London in Royal Navy, $15. 3. Chanel Le Vernis Nail Colour in Alchimie, $27. 4. Tom Ford Nail Lacquer in Toasted Sugar, $32. 5. Nars Nail Polish in Hunger, $20.
If you want the biggest bang for your buck…

1. Essie Nail Polish in Recessionista, $8.50. 2. OPI Nail Lacquer in Russian Navy, $6.99. 3. Revlon Nail Enamel in Gold Coin, $4.99. 4. Essie Nail Polish in Sand Tropez, $8.50. 5. China Glaze Nail Polish in Roguish Red, $4.45.
